Key Interpretations and Ideas
To understand the distinctions between Surety Contract bonds and insurance, it's essential to grasp vital interpretations and concepts.
Surety Contract bonds are a three-party arrangement where the guaranty assures the Performance of a contractual commitment by the principal to the obligee. The principal is the party that obtains the bond, the obligee is the party that calls for the bond, and the surety is the celebration that ensures the Performance.
Insurance coverage, on the other hand, is a two-party contract where the insurance firm consents to compensate the insured for specified losses or problems for the settlement of premiums.

Application and Approval Process
Once you have actually picked the sort of coverage you require, the following action is to understand the application and approval procedure for obtaining Surety Contract bonds or insurance policy.
For Surety Contract bonds, the procedure normally includes sending an application to a surety firm along with relevant monetary records and job information. The guaranty company will certainly evaluate your financial toughness, experience, and online reputation to determine if you're eligible for bond protection. This process can take a few weeks, relying on the complexity of the task and the surety firm's workload.
On the other hand, obtaining insurance usually includes completing an application form and giving standard details about your organization. The insurer will assess the danger connected with your company and give a quote based upon that assessment. The authorization procedure for insurance policy is usually quicker contrasted to surety Contract bonds.
